Responsibilities
- Oversee daily front desk operations, ensuring efficiency and high standards of guest service.
- Supervise, train, and mentor front desk staff to foster a culture of excellence and teamwork.
- Manage guest check-ins, check-outs, and inquiries with a focus on resolving issues and exceeding expectations.
- Monitor and maintain accurate records of room inventory, reservations, and guest feedback.
- Collaborate with housekeeping and maintenance teams to ensure room readiness and quality control.
- Handle high-profile VIP guests and corporate accounts with the utmost professionalism.
- Assist in the creation of staff schedules and manage payroll and overtime.
Qualifications
- Minimum of 2-3 years of experience in a supervisory role within a luxury hotel or upscale hospitality establishment.
- Proven track record in guest relations and front desk management.
- Proficiency in Property Management Systems (PMS) such as Opera, Micros, or similar.
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ills in English.
- Strong leadership abilities and the capacity to work in a fast-paced, high-pressure environment.
- Flexibility to work evenings, weekends, and holidays as required.
- A valid Hospitality Service Certificate or degree is preferred.
